Weinstein A+U’s Canon printer has been replaced with a Xerox C70. You'll now see this printer available in your print dialogue windows along with four Xerox presets to choose from.
In addition, an application called PaperCut has been installed on your computer. PaperCut is a print management system which helps to secure and simplify the printing experience. After sending a document to a Xerox printer, you'll receive a prompt to select an account where your document will be charged to. PaperCut runs silently in the background and includes a menubar item near the clock. From this you can login into your PaperCut account, hough it is generally not nessessary. When prompted, enter your PaperCut credentials. The username format is firstname last initial (megana). The password is your 4-digit employee ID.
Since PaperCut is required to run in the background at all times, it is highly recommended this application be added to your Login Items to avoid having to manually launch PaperCut each time you use your computer.
